[0041] refer to the attached figure 1 , the building panels 1 are substantially rectangular in plan view and have opposing major end edge surfaces 2 interconnected by opposing major side edge surfaces 3 defining a surrounding A perimeter edge 4 consisting of alternating oppositely inwardly stepped portions 5 and oppositely outwardly stepped portions 6 . Panel 1 comprises one inwardly stepped portion 5 and one outwardly stepped portion 6 or protrusion along each major end edge surface 2 and two inwardly stepped portions 5 and two along each major side edge surface 3 Outwardly stepped portion 6 or protrusion. The length of each inwardly stepped portion 5 is configured to accommodate a complementary outwardly stepped portion 6 of a coplanar or orthogonal adjacent similar panel 1 , the stepped portions 5 , 6 being configured to wrap around a major side surface perpendicular to the panel 1 . Abstract

A building panel (1) has a major plane and is configured to interengage with at least one other adjacent like panel. The panel (1) has two major side surfaces (16) which are parallel to the major plane, and four major edge surfaces (2, 3) forming a perimeter (4) of the panel (1). An over-centre camlock mechanism (7) is retractably extendable from each major edge surface (2, 3). Each major edge surface (2, 3) has a recess with an associated recess (17) at each major side surface (16), so that each recess is adjacent to at least one other recess. There is a pin in each recess and any over-centre camlock mechanism (7) is latchingly engageable with the pin in any one of the recesses of the adjacent like panel so that the major planes of the two panels, when interengaged, are selectively parallel and coincident or perpendicular.

Description

technical field [0001] The present invention relates to a building panel, and more particularly to a building panel that is mounted in an inter-engaging manner with at least one other adjacent similar building panel. Background technique [0002] WO 2004 / 074593 discloses a quadrilateral building panel having a rotational symmetry of at least two degrees when rotated about a central axis extending perpendicular to a plane comprising the main plane of the panel. The structure can be constructed using a plurality of such panels mounted in interengagement, with adjacent panels secured to each other by locking cams. However, the document does not disclose how the locking cams can secure adjacent building panels to each other such that their major planes are substantially parallel and aligned or substantially perpendicular.
